首页 > 分享 > 基于Boid模型的动物集群运动行为研究.pdf资源

基于Boid模型的动物集群运动行为研究.pdf资源

"基于Boid模型的动物集群运动行为研究" 本文通过对Boid模型进行研究并进行改进,运用MATLAB软件对群体在不同环境下的运动进行仿真,形象地展现了动物的集群运动行为。本研究的主要贡献是将Boid模型与Lead-follower模型相结合,模拟动物集群运动行为,同时考虑了捕食者对个体的影响和信息丰富者的引导作用。 问题一:在Boid模型的基础上,添加了内聚性、排列性和可变速性三个原则,进行加权建立函数关系,运用MATLAB进行仿真,很好地模拟出了动物的集群运动。个体的位置变化公式为: iiiidirec1(t)pos(t 1)pos(t)*v(t)direc1(t) 问题二:在问题一的基础上,增加了在两种不同情况下个体躲避天敌的原则:当个体离天敌较近时,忽略群体的影响,选择最快方向逃逸;当个体离天敌较远时,主要考虑逃逸,但仍考虑群体的对个体的影响。当个体无法感受到天敌时,按第一问的原则进行运动。对不同环境下的个体建立了不同的函数关系式,使整体效果更加接近实际情况。 问题三:考虑了一部分个体是信息丰富者,设 置了含有食物的场景,在第一问原则的基础上采 用Lead-follower模型,确 定 了信息丰富者能第一时间 发现食物并向其 缓慢前 进,对其他个体进行引 导,达 到群体向食物前 进的效果,并且 通过MATLAB 进行仿真,得到了群体的运动情况。 在动物世界,大量集结成群进行移动或者觅食的例子并不少见,这种现象在食草动物、鸟、鱼和昆虫中都存在。这些动物群在运动过程中具有明显的特征:群中的个体聚集性很强,运动方向、速度具有一致性。通过数学模型来模拟动物群的集群运动行为以及探索动物群中信息传递机制一直是仿生学领域的一项重要内容。 本研究的模型假设包括:群体所处环境不受天气、气候的影响;群体中的个体之间没有竞争;群体的活动范围有限;个体的感知范围是一个圆形区域。 符号说明包括:direc1:个体的本来方向;direc2:指向邻居中心的方向;direc3:邻居的平均方向;direc4:避免碰撞的方向;direc5:远离捕食者的方向;direc6:捕食者运动方向的反方向;direc7:群体的平均位置;direc8:群体的平均方向;v:速度;food:食物的位置;pre:捕食者的位置;ipos:第i个个体的位置;cons:一致性序数;n:群体的个数;m:邻居的个数。 本研究的结果表明,基于Boid模型的动物集群运动行为研究能够很好地模拟动物的集群运动行为,并且考虑了捕食者对个体的影响和信息丰富者的引导作用。这种模型可以应用于仿生学、机器人学、自动控制等领域,具有广泛的应用前景。

相关知识

基于Boid模型的动物集群运动行为研究.pdf资源
动物集群运动行为仿真模拟
基于DOG的异常行为监测模型的设计
动物疫情危机下养殖户行为决策的分析——基于ISM模型
基于红外相机技术的白冠长尾雉集群行为研究
基于姿态关键点的小鼠运动行为量化分析方法研究
基于双流特征提取的哺乳动物行为识别方法及模型
基于啮齿类动物的决策行为研究及其脑机制(PDF)
动物行为记录
动物行为研究的新进展(二)分子遗传学与动物行为.pdf

网址: 基于Boid模型的动物集群运动行为研究.pdf资源 https://m.mcbbbk.com/newsview502031.html

所属分类:萌宠日常
上一篇: 小猫和小狗,大大的不同
下一篇: 物体认知——基于动物自发行为的一